Obituary for Judy Ann Chargot

Judy Chargot was a beloved wife, mother, sister and dear friend to so many. After a courageous battle with cancer she went to be with God on April 3, 2023 at 70 years young. Judy was surrounded by her family who filled her world with joy and happiness and were by her side until her very last breath.

Born to Helen and Charles Barrett on September 5, 1952 in her home town of Port Huron, Michigan. Judy spent most of her life there and always considered it home. She married her 4th grade square dance partner, Michael Chargot Jr. in 1976. They had 2 beautiful daughters, Christee Chargot and Dr. Michelle DiLella and their very special son in law Robert DiLella Jr. She is also survived by her sisters, Barbara Vollmer (Dennis Vollmer), Pat Strehl (Chuck Strehl), and brothers Tom Barrett (Sandi Barrett), and Charlie Barrett (Bonnie Barrett). Also, her precious caretaker Yeyvelin Palomo who was by her side during the last year of her life and loved her like her own family. She has many special nieces, nephews, grandchildren and great-grand children as well as many devoted friends.

Judy filled everyday with joy and was a constant inspiration with her devoting love for family and friends, always making the most of every day. She had a passion for travel, volunteering, dancing and knitting baby blankets. Judy and Mike won their last dance contest on a cruise in 2019. Even though cancer entered her life, she never stopped from continuing her many friendships filled with laughter and joy. What a gift to all of us, as she was known for her contagious laugh, constant smile, true kindness and love for Jesus Christ.

True to her determination and goals, Judy earned her education degree from Central Michigan University and her Master’s in Education from Saginaw Valley. Her passion for teaching radiated through Port Huron for 30 years as she taught kindergarten, Physical Education and 2nd grade. She was blessed to be everyone’s favorite teacher, no matter their age. She absolutely loved all of her kids in her class, and she passed on her joy of teaching to benefit so many children and adults.
